@wordpress/shortcode

Shortcode module for WordPress.

Installation

Install the module

npm install @wordpress/shortcode --save

This package assumes that your code will run in an ES2015+ environment. If you’re using an environment that has limited or no support for such language features and APIs, you should include the polyfill shipped in @wordpress/babel-preset-default in your code.

API

attrs

Parse shortcode attributes.

Shortcodes accept many types of attributes. These can chiefly be divided into named and numeric attributes:

Named attributes are assigned on a key/value basis, while numeric attributes are treated as an array.

Named attributes can be formatted as either name="value", name='value', or name=value. Numeric attributes can be formatted as "value" or just value.

Parameters

  • text string: Serialised shortcode attributes.

Returns

  • WPShortcodeAttrs: Parsed shortcode attributes.

default

Creates a shortcode instance.

To access a raw representation of a shortcode, pass an options object, containing a tag string, a string or object of attrs, a string indicating the type of the shortcode (‘single’, ‘self-closing’, or ‘closed’), and a content string.

Parameters

  • options Object: Options as described.

Returns

  • WPShortcode: Shortcode instance.

fromMatch

Generate a Shortcode Object from a RegExp match.

Accepts a match object from calling regexp.exec() on a RegExp generated by regexp(). match can also be set to the arguments from a callback passed to regexp.replace().

Parameters

  • match Array: Match array.

Returns

  • WPShortcode: Shortcode instance.

regexp

Generate a RegExp to identify a shortcode.

The base regex is functionally equivalent to the one found in get_shortcode_regex() in wp-includes/shortcodes.php.

Capture groups:

  1. An extra [ to allow for escaping shortcodes with double [[]]
  2. The shortcode name
  3. The shortcode argument list
  4. The self closing /
  5. The content of a shortcode when it wraps some content.
  6. The closing tag.
  7. An extra ] to allow for escaping shortcodes with double [[]]

Parameters

  • tag string: Shortcode tag.

Returns

  • RegExp: Shortcode RegExp.

replace

Replace matching shortcodes in a block of text.

Parameters

  • tag string: Shortcode tag.
  • text string: Text to search.
  • callback Function: Function to process the match and return replacement string.

Returns

  • string: Text with shortcodes replaced.

string

Generate a string from shortcode parameters.

Creates a shortcode instance and returns a string.

Accepts the same options as the shortcode() constructor, containing a tag string, a string or object of attrs, a boolean indicating whether to format the shortcode using a single tag, and a content string.

Parameters

  • options Object:

Returns

  • string: String representation of the shortcode.
